PAUL COWAN WHOSE EMOTIONALLY CHARGED, INVENTIVELY CRAFTED FILM WESTRAY TOOK THIS YEAR'S GENIE FOR BEST DOCUMENTARY, SEES MOVIEMAKING AS AN OPPORTUNITY TO STEP INTO LIVES RADICALLY DIFFERENT FROM HIS OWN. COWAN SAYS THAT THE WANDERER IN HIM KICKED IN WHEN HE WAS A SUBURBAN TORONTO TEENAGER, AND HE DID THINGS LIKE "TAKE A BUS TO NEW YORK TO HANG OUT WITH THE WEIRDOS, THE PROSTITUTES AND PIMPS DOWN IN GREENWICH VILLAGE. I WAS IN HEAVEN." EVEN TODAY, LIVING IN THE COMFORTABLE MONTREAL HOME HE SHARES WITH TWO DAUGHTERS AND HIS WIFE OF 20 YEARS, CBC RADIO ONE JAZZ HOST KATIE MALLOCH, COWAN STILL HAS THAT INEXPLICABLE URGE.
